Transaction 103dae231a3758449b92a7d0ebd2893b0b756b8df3b208d3d3b4d4386352fd1e
1 Input
1 Output
-
103dae231a3758449b92a7d0ebd2893b0b756b8df3b208d3d3b4d4386352fd1e:0
- value
- 4058066
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b85444d0fb91be91b364394df4da753d468f368 OP_EQUAL
- address
- 3A2w4YGjamNan8eeWjmwJSkMenV8Z3k9ik